The Golden State Warriors have a new head coach in Steve Kerr. Their old coach, Mark Jackson, already has a new job with ESPN covering the remainder of the NBA playoffs. But information is still surfacing regarding Jackson’s issues with management during his tenure with Golden State.

Per the SF Bay, Jackson made remarks that could be viewed as anti-gay.

Jackson was asked about the possibility of adding several different big men to the roster. Jason Collins name was mentioned prior to his signing a contract with the Brooklyn Nets. Collins is the first openly gay NBA player. Jackson reportedly responded:

“Not in my locker room.”

The Warriors are planning a new stadium in the heart of San Francisco. A city that has a large and active homosexual community that enjoys sports and has discretionary income to spend. Can’t imagine that would’ve been good for community relations. Warriors owner Joe Lacob isn’t commenting and says the team has moved on.
